人工智能(AI)通过多种方式来听懂我们说话。以下是一些主要的技术和方法:
1. 语音识别(Speech Recognition):这是AI最基础的能力之一,它使机器能够将我们的语音转换为文本。语音识别技术通常依赖于深度学习和神经网络,这些技术可以从大量的语音数据中学习如何将语音信号转换为文字。例如,Google的语音识别服务就采用了这种技术。
2. 自然语言处理(Natural Language Processing, NLP):NLP是AI的另一个重要领域,它使机器能够理解和生成人类语言。NLP技术包括词法分析、句法分析和语义分析等步骤,以解析和理解我们的语言。例如,IBM的Watson就是一个使用NLP技术的聊天机器人。
3. 机器学习(Machine Learning):机器学习是一种让计算机从数据中学习和改进的方法。通过训练模型,AI可以逐渐提高其对语言的理解能力。例如,Google的BERT模型就是一种基于机器学习的自然语言处理技术。
4. 深度学习(Deep Learning):深度学习是一种模仿人脑神经网络结构的机器学习方法。通过大量的数据和复杂的网络结构,深度学习可以更好地理解和处理语言。例如,Google的GPT-3就是基于深度学习的自然语言处理技术。
5. 注意力机制(Attention Mechanism):在理解语言时,AI需要关注到重要的信息。注意力机制可以帮助AI在输入的大量信息中选择和关注到最重要的部分。例如,BERT模型中的“attention”机制就是基于注意力机制的一种实现。
6. 上下文理解(Contextual Understanding):在理解语言时,AI需要考虑上下文信息。通过分析句子的前后文,AI可以更好地理解句子的含义。例如,Google的BERT模型就考虑了句子的上下文信息。
7. 对话管理(Dialogue Management):在与用户进行自然语言交互时,AI需要管理对话流程。这包括识别用户的输入、生成相应的回答以及根据对话内容调整策略。例如,IBM的Watson就具备对话管理的能力。
8. 情感分析(Sentiment Analysis):在理解语言时,AI还需要识别用户的情感。这有助于提供更人性化的服务。例如,Amazon的Alexa就具备情感分析的功能。
总之,通过上述技术和方法,AI能够听懂我们说话并给出相应的回应。随着技术的不断发展,AI在理解和处理语言方面的能力将不断提高,为我们的生活带来更多便利。